目的:观察活血养血汤对兔脊髓缺血再灌注损伤Cytc、Hsp70、Bcl-2、Bax表达的影响,探讨其作用机制。方法:新西兰大白兔随机分成手术假手术组、手术组、药物对照组和活血养血汤组,每组30只,术前1周分别灌服0.9%氯化钠溶液、桃红四物汤和活血养血汤,假手术组只分离出腰动脉,其余3组制作脊髓缺血再灌注损伤模型,4组分别于缺血再灌注后0.5、1、4、8、12h检测Cytc、Hsp70、Bcl-2、Bax表达。结果:药物对照组和活血养血汤组各时间点Cytc表达较手术组有显著下降(P<0.05,P<0.01),活血养血汤组较药物对照组各时间点相比有显著下降(P<0.05,P<0.01);药物对照组与活血养血汤组Hsp70和Bcl-2表达在4、8、12h较手术组明显升高(P<0.05,P<0.01),8、12h活血养血汤组较药物对照组显著升高(P<0.05,P<0.01);药物对照组和活血养血汤组Bax表达各时间点均低于手术组(P<0.05,P<0.01),且活血养血汤组低于药物对照组(P<0.05,P<0.01)。结论:桃红四物汤和活血养血汤可通过降低Cytc、Bax,升高Hsp70、Bcl-2的表达调控细胞凋亡,减轻损伤,活血养血汤后期作用优于单纯活血化瘀法。
Objective: To observe the effect of Huoxue Yangxue Decoction on the expression of Cytc, Hsp70, Bcl-2 and Bax after spinal cord ischemia-reperfusion injury in rabbits and to explore its mechanism. Methods: New Zealand white rabbits were randomly divided into operation sham operation group, operation group, drug control group and Huoxue Yangxue Decoction group, 30 rats in each group. 0.9% sodium chloride solution, Taohong Siwu Decoction and blood circulation Yangxue Decoction and sham operation group, only the lumbar artery was isolated, and the other three groups were made into the model of spinal cord ischemia-reperfusion injury. The four groups were respectively detected Cytc, Hsp70 and Bcl- 2, Bax expression. Results: The expression of Cytc in drug control group and Huoxue Yangxue Decoction group were significantly lower than those in operation group (P <0.05, P <0.01), and Huoxue Yangxue Decoction group was significantly lower than that in drug control group at each time point P <0.05, P <0.01). The expression of Hsp70 and Bcl-2 in the drug control group and Huoxue Yangxue Decoction group were significantly higher than those in the operation group at 4,8 and 12 h (P <0.05, P <0.01) Yangxue Decoction group was significantly higher than the drug control group (P <0.05, P <0.01); Bax expression of the drug control group and Huoxue Yangxue Decoction group were lower than those of the operation group at each time point (P <0.05, P <0.01) And Huoxue Yangxue Decoction group was lower than the drug control group (P <0.05, P <0.01). Conclusion: Taohong Siwu Decoction and Huoxue Yangxue Decoction can regulate apoptosis and reduce injury by decreasing the expression of Cytc, Bax, increasing the expression of Hsp70 and Bcl-2. The effect of Huoxue Yangxue Decoction is better than that of promoting blood circulation and removing blood stasis alone.
